3840x5376 a54e9f05ea0ee8cbd618a170af0abeb40804fac114a5f47d

3840x5376 a54e9f05ea0ee8cbd618a170af0abeb40804fac114a5f47d

23 views

3840 × 5376 — JPEG 1.9 MB

Uploaded 4 months ago

No description provided.